yes, air back cover kind of strange. Have no idea what caused that.

one of the tab of the lower panel broke off; that is why you see the panel hanging.

the a/c cabin filter is inside this panel and also the main ecu is inside too.

dont worry about the lower panel as it is hang up by some clips. But you may need to investigate the wavy airbag panel, it might be the indication of airbag having been deployed. in other words, the car might be in a serious accident
